Episode 12 is a conversation with Akanksha Savanal, who is the founder of A Curve Story. In this episode, we talk about her journey from becoming a stylist to the founder of her own firm. She had a vision of making fashion accessible, inclusive, and intersectional and that is when A Curve Story was born. She also talks in-depth about the research she had done to make sure that all the problems of the people were heard and she took steps to solve them.

Akanksha started her styling journey when she was just 18 years old. She has worked with numerous celebrities like Ranveer Singh, Priyanka Chopra, and Ayushmann Khurana and has created a niche for herself. While working as a stylist she noticed that there was a gap in the fashion options available for curvy women. She decided to bridge this gap with her startup A Curve Story. A Curve Story promotes fashion that is accessible, inclusive, and intersectional. It provides fluid fashion options not only for women with curves but also for the LGBTQIA community. Akanksha believes that clothes are meant to fit people and not the other way round.
